### Tightening SO₂ Regulations Worldwide

The single most powerful catalyst for the Flue Gas Desulfurization Market is the progressive ratcheting of SO₂ emission ceilings. The EU's revised BAT-AEL range now requires large combustion plants to emit no more than 10–50 mg/Nm³ of SO₂, down from 150 mg/Nm³ under earlier guidelines. Compliance has forced operators to upgrade from basic limestone slurry loops to high-performance wet limestone FGD scrubber configurations with in-situ forced oxidation. China's ULE standard (≤35 mg/Nm³) has already driven USD 18 billion in cumulative FGD investments since 2015, with an additional USD 6 billion earmarked for non-power industrial sources through 2028 [[1]](https://ec.europa.eu)[[2]](https://mee.gov.cn).

### Coal Fleet Expansion in Emerging Asia

Despite global decarbonization rhetoric, the Asia-Pacific pipeline contains over 190 GW of coal capacity under construction or in advanced planning as of 2025, predominantly in India, Vietnam, Indonesia, and Bangladesh [[9]](https://iea.org). Each new unit requires an integrated FGD system — typically a wet limestone FGD scrubber or spray dry absorber SDA FGD system — adding roughly USD 40–60 million per 500 MW unit. India's Central Electricity Authority mandated FGD installation across 166 GW of existing coal capacity by December 2026, creating a USD 4.5 billion order pipeline that underpins the Flue Gas Desulfurization Market in South Asia [[8]](https://cea.nic.in).

### Industrial Emission Norms Beyond Power Generation

Cement kilns, copper smelters, glass furnaces, and waste incinerators are increasingly subject to SO₂ limits that mirror power-sector standards. The EU's Medium Combustion Plant Directive (MCPD) now covers units as small as 1 MWth, opening a new addressable segment for compact dry sorbent injection DSI FGD units and CFB dry FGD fluidized bed reactors [[6]](https://eea.europa.eu). In the United States, the EPA's Brick MACT and Portland Cement NESHAP rules have together compelled over 80 facilities to install FGD controls since 2023 [[5]](https://epa.gov).

### Gypsum Byproduct Valorization

Revenue from synthetic gypsum — a saleable byproduct of wet limestone FGD scrubber operations — is improving project economics. The global wallboard industry consumed approximately 28 million tonnes of FGD gypsum in 2024, valued at USD 1.2 billion [[13]](https://usgs.gov). Operators who integrate gypsum byproduct FGD wet scrubber dewatering and processing lines are recovering 8–12% of total annualized operating costs, turning a waste-disposal liability into a revenue stream that strengthens the investment case for new FGD installations.

### High Capital and Operating Costs

A full-scale wet limestone FGD scrubber for a 600 MW coal unit can cost USD 150–250 million, with annual O&M adding 2–3% of CAPEX. For developing-country utilities already burdened by tariff subsidies, this cost barrier delays compliance. It compresses the Flue Gas Desulfurization Market's near-term growth in regions like Sub-Saharan Africa and parts of South Asia [[15]](https://adb.org).

### Coal Phase-Out Policies

Germany plans to exit coal by 2038, the UK by 2024 (already achieved), and Canada by 2030. As coal plants retire, the addressable installed base for FGD equipment shrinks. However, the phase-out effect is partly offset by the need for continued operation — and therefore emission control — during extended transition periods, as well as by the transfer of FGD expertise to [waste-to-energy](https://www.marketresearchfuture.com/reports/waste-to-energy-market-1369) and biomass co-firing applications [[14]](https://ec.europa.eu).

### Water Scarcity and Wet FGD Constraints

Wet FGD systems consume 0.4–0.8 m³ of water per MWh, a significant concern in water-stressed regions such as western China, Rajasthan (India), and parts of the Middle East. This constraint is steering some operators toward spray dry absorber SDA FGD systems or dry sorbent injection DSI FGD alternatives that reduce water use by 80–95% [[16]](https://wri.org).

### CFB Dry Scrubbing for Waste-to-Energy

The global waste-to-energy sector is projected to add 25 GW of capacity between 2026 and 2035 [[19]](https://irena.org). Municipal solid waste combustion produces variable flue gas chemistry that favors flexible CFB dry FGD fluidized bed systems over conventional wet scrubbers. Compact footprints and lower water requirements make dry FGD particularly attractive for urban waste-to-energy plants where space and water are constrained

### Marine Scrubbing in Coastal Power and Refining

Coastal facilities with access to seawater can deploy FGD seawater scrubbing SO₂ removal systems that eliminate the need for limestone procurement. The Middle East's USD 3.2 billion refinery expansion pipeline along the Arabian Gulf coast presents a prime addressable opportunity, particularly where zero-liquid-discharge requirements do not apply [[10]](https://saudiaramco.com).

Wet limestone FGD scrubber systems dominate the Flue Gas Desulfurization Market because they deliver >97% SO₂ removal at scale with well-understood chemistry. The technology's installed base exceeds 350 GW globally, and the forced-oxidation wallboard-grade gypsum variant has become the default configuration for units above 300 MW. Reagent costs remain manageable at USD 2–4 per tonne of limestone in most regions, and system lifespans routinely exceed 30 years with proper maintenance.

Spray dry absorber SDA FGD system technology is the fastest-growing segment, driven by its suitability for sub-300 MW boilers and its lower water consumption compared with wet systems. In the waste-to-energy sector, SDA units paired with fabric-filter baghouses deliver simultaneous SO₂, HCl, and dioxin control, making them the preferred choice for new municipal solid waste incinerators across Europe and Japan.

China's Flue Gas Desulfurization Market is transitioning from new-build installations to upgrade-and-replacement cycles as first-generation scrubbers installed during the 11th Five-Year Plan (2006–2010) reach end-of-life. India remains the single largest growth pocket, with the Central Electricity Authority tracking FGD bids worth USD 2.8 billion issued between January 2024 and March 2025 alone. Southeast Asian markets are earlier in the compliance curve, creating a multi-year pipeline for wet limestone FGD scrubber exports from Chinese and Indian OEMs.

The U.S. Flue Gas Desulfurization Market is shifting from greenfield installation to life-extension and performance optimization. With the average U.S. FGD system now 18 years old, utilities are investing in absorber tray replacements, mist eliminator upgrades, and reagent-feed automation. The Good Neighbor Plan's 2026 compliance deadline for 23 upwind states has accelerated this cycle [[5]](https://epa.gov).

**Q: How does the total cost of ownership for a wet limestone FGD scrubber compare with a spray dry absorber SDA FGD system over a 25-year plant life?**
A: A wet FGD system costs roughly USD 250–400/kW installed but benefits from lower reagent costs at scale, yielding a 25-year levelized cost approximately 15–20% below SDA for units above 300 MW [4]. Below 200 MW, SDA's lower water and waste-handling costs often make it the more economical choice.

**Q: What permitting lead times should project developers expect when retrofitting FGD onto an existing coal plant in the Flue Gas Desulfurization Market?**
A: Retrofit permitting in the U.S. typically takes 18–30 months, encompassing air-quality modeling, state implementation plan review, and construction permits [5]. In India, approvals can extend to 36 months due to concurrent environmental and water-use clearances.

**Q: Can FGD seawater scrubbing SO₂ removal systems operate in regions with high-turbidity coastal water?**
A: High suspended-solids levels above 50 mg/L can foul absorber internals and raise maintenance costs significantly [10]. Pre-treatment with sand filters or dissolved-air flotation is standard practice, adding 8–12% to CAPEX.

**Q: How do carbon-credit mechanisms interact with FGD investment decisions in the Flue Gas Desulfurization Market?**
A: While FGD systems do not directly reduce CO₂, EU ETS carbon prices above EUR 80/tonne incentivize multi-pollutant upgrades that bundle FGD with SCR and mercury controls into single outage windows [14]. This bundling lowers per-pollutant compliance costs.

**Q: What workforce training is required to operate a CFB dry FGD fluidized bed system safely?**
A: Operators typically need 80–120 hours of specialized training covering sorbent handling, baghouse tuning, and ash-disposal procedures [4]. OEMs like Andritz and FLSmidth offer certified programs bundled with equipment purchases.

**Q: How is the gypsum byproduct FGD wet scrubber market affected by construction-industry downturns?**
A: A 10% drop in wallboard demand can reduce FGD gypsum offtake prices by 20–25%, pushing disposal costs back onto plant operators [13]. Long-term offtake contracts with wallboard manufacturers mitigate this volatility.

**Q: What role does dry sorbent injection DSI FGD play in the Flue Gas Desulfurization Market for facilities with limited shutdown windows?**
A: DSI systems can be installed during planned maintenance outages as short as two weeks because they require minimal ductwork modification [4]. This makes DSI the preferred emergency-compliance pathway for plants facing imminent regulatory deadlines.
